Demystifying Wagering Requirements and Withdrawal Rules at Amonbet

Ever scratched your head over what wagering requirements actually mean when chasing Amonbet bonuses? Let’s keep it simple. Wagering requirements are like the casino’s “receipt” rules—you have to play through a bonus (and sometimes your deposit) a certain number of times before you can withdraw any winnings. Imagine borrowing money to bet; the house wants to see you spin or punt their cash several rounds before you convert it to cold, hard cash out.

For Amonbet bonuses, expect typical hurdles around 35-40x the combined amount of your deposit plus bonus. So if you grabbed a £100 bonus, you’re looking at wagering roughly £3,500 to £4,000 before even thinking about cashing out. Free spins winnings often come with similar strings attached, usually around 30-40x wagering and max-win caps, often £50 or less, which trims that dream day payout sadly.

When you spin or bet using bonus money or free spins, those funds are in a “locked” state until you clear the wagering requirements. Withdraw before ticking them off, and boom—the bonus cash plus wins vanish faster than your last pint on a Friday night.

Casual players often stumble on “sticky” or sneaky terms nestled in the small print. These might mean that some games barely count toward clearing wagering or set low max bets during bonus play (usually around £1-£5 per spin), which slows progress. Some payment methods, like Skrill or Neteller, might exclude you from claiming bonuses or cause automatic cancellation.

Slot and Sportsbook Action: What’s Worth Your Time?

Jumping into slots with bonus spins is a classic move, but not all pokies play fair when it comes to clearing bonus wagers. High RTP (Return to Player) slots matter here—they give you a better statistical shot at sticking around long enough to meet those wagering hoops. Games like Gates of Olympus 1000 by Pragmatic Play or Gold Rush with Johnny Cash from BGaming are often favourites because their RTP hovers nicely around or above 96%.

In Amonbet’s extensive library, you’ll spot huge branded slots that pull crowds—think Johnny Cash or Book of Gods from Big Time Gaming—versus lesser-known gems that can quietly rack up solid wins and faster wagering clears. Big-name slots might offer flashier gameplay, but sometimes their slot volatility or payout structure makes pure bonus churn less efficient. Those hidden gems can surprise you and burn through wagering quicker under the right conditions.

Sportsbook bonus cash at Amonbet comes with a different vibe. You can use bonus money to punt on various sports markets, which broadens the fun and strategy beyond reels. However, clearing bonus funds through sportsbook bets often differs from slots. Sports bets might only count a fraction towards wagering or have minimum odds requirements—bets below 1.5 typically won’t clear any bonus.
